Join us for our fully revamped “San Juan Archeology” program as we travel to the true southwestern part of the state to learn about indigenous history, culture and archeological findings. Our first day will be spent locally- getting to know each other, participating in team-building activities and adventuring outside. On Tuesday we’ll head to Crow Canyon Archaeological Center’s campus for two days of hands-on, interactive programming. It is here, on Crow Canyon’s 170-acre campus, that our students will dive deep into ancestral culture and archeological science to learn about the complex interactions between people and their environments. Students will sleep in rustic cabins modeled after Navajo hogans and embrace sweeping views of gorgeous meadows and pinyon and juniper covered hillsides. On Thursday, we’ll head to Mesa Verde National Park to learn about the historically thriving communities and rich cultural heritage of 26 different indigenous tribes.
